Output 17569e2dc593328fd1fa28f27dea02b42bf70ea577319c59c2ad3a216d05bb0b:0

value
9365606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 726a4411e1e165e1c0bd7fed465912316b6fef2d OP_EQUAL
address
3C7zFtwu6TRvsMwtBh44v9833qG7w2u8hj
transaction
17569e2dc593328fd1fa28f27dea02b42bf70ea577319c59c2ad3a216d05bb0b
confirmations
178030
spent
true